diff options
author | Julien HENRY <julien.henry@sonarsource.com> | 2024-04-16 18:20:26 +0200 |
---|---|---|
committer | Matteo Mara <matteo.mara@sonarsource.com> | 2024-04-30 10:59:02 +0200 |
commit | 7a68e525099ff79027c2aee162da3d05b92fd6aa (patch) | |
tree | a47b823375af38d23cef0692b5bf29aee6dd9013 /sonar-scanner-engine/src/main/java/org/sonar/batch/bootstrapper/Batch.java | |
parent | ad945cbe450bce968e0bd6c9f33027e8c6c73c35 (diff) | |
download | sonarqube-7a68e525099ff79027c2aee162da3d05b92fd6aa.tar.gz sonarqube-7a68e525099ff79027c2aee162da3d05b92fd6aa.zip |
SONAR-22086 Add support to configure scanner with env variables
Diffstat (limited to 'sonar-scanner-engine/src/main/java/org/sonar/batch/bootstrapper/Batch.java')
-rw-r--r-- | sonar-scanner-engine/src/main/java/org/sonar/batch/bootstrapper/Batch.java |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/sonar-scanner-engine/src/main/java/org/sonar/batch/bootstrapper/Batch.java b/sonar-scanner-engine/src/main/java/org/sonar/batch/bootstrapper/Batch.java index 75a6a1bdee8..19b90c180fa 100644 --- a/sonar-scanner-engine/src/main/java/org/sonar/batch/bootstrapper/Batch.java +++ b/sonar-scanner-engine/src/main/java/org/sonar/batch/bootstrapper/Batch.java @@ -26,6 +26,7 @@ import java.util.List; import java.util.Map; import javax.annotation.Nullable; import org.sonar.api.utils.MessageException; +import org.sonar.scanner.bootstrap.EnvironmentConfig; import org.sonar.scanner.bootstrap.SpringGlobalContainer; /** @@ -47,6 +48,7 @@ public final class Batch { } if (builder.globalProperties != null) { globalProperties.putAll(builder.globalProperties); + EnvironmentConfig.processEnvVariables(globalProperties); } if (builder.isEnableLoggingConfiguration()) { loggingConfig = new LoggingConfiguration(builder.environment).setProperties(globalProperties); |